| robbiehaf's Full Review: Uniden EXAI 7980 900 MHz - Cordless Phone |
I checked opinions here before shopping for a cordless phone/answering machine. This was the highest rated in my price range (actually below my price range). I am so happy I looked here first! This is a great phone! It has all the features I needed (plus some) and it came at a great price - I ordered this online, refurbished, for $49.95.
What can I say? It has it all. I've had problems in the past with cordless phone in my house. Not this one! The phone has a very long range. I even use it outside, all the way to the edge of my yard. The headphone jack comes in handy while I'm gardening, cooking, or on the computer. It even includes a belt clip. It's very convenient to be able to answer calls on the speaker phone at the base. I just wish it had a dial pad. The answering machine and memory dial functions are easy to use. I don't use the caller ID, so I can't tell you anything about this.
My only real complaint, which is a small one, is that the phone hand set has a sticker on it informing you about caller ID functions. It's a very large, bright sticker that had to be removed for cosmetic reasons. I peeled it off, but it left a sticky film that was nearly impossible to remove. I finally got it off with some nail polish remover a lot of scrubbing.
